Output ec5bb58b19357d508907cef1ff76d83dcc56f54d89772eb149e1267ef5a0666a:1

value
87620317
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 29b2b22b826441d0853caafb8dbbf8303431de4c OP_EQUALVERIFY OP_CHECKSIG
address
14oUmszUeyUpx3gLThsEhW4cxLyoxfh9GJ
transaction
ec5bb58b19357d508907cef1ff76d83dcc56f54d89772eb149e1267ef5a0666a
spent
true